About This Item
Mt. Horeb, WI: Perishable Press, 1969. Original Wrappers. Near Fine binding. Oblong 12mo. [16] pp., illus. Limited edition, one of 250 copies, signed by Wakoski at the colophon. Printed in black Palatino on handmade ivory-colored Shadwell paper sewn into Fabriano paper covers with jacket and acronym of the title:author stamped in blind on the front; "illustrated by an anonymous diagram of the mechnics fo the piano, key and wire, etc." Hamady notes in the bibliography, "This paper was couched on the 'magic felt' which was gratis from a papermill here in Wisconsin. It was loaded with pigment from its last job, so each pressing produced a different color in the sheet, beginning with a hot pink & lighter to an orange & on to Ivory & finally off-white with light tangerine deckles!" Two Decades of Hamady & the Perishable Press, 24. A beautiful fine printing of Wakoski's haunting poem.
